Output 69bab61c55b8d29cfdb0380cd85f2a8e41a2f2f889f5e05bbbf8aa4d28bcf94b:0

value
1340775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c85def045795eac8194c2d11af69d6042e1c10c OP_EQUAL
address
3EW2tujV6ogprRrJR7uuokbxQuDE5AFkGP
transaction
69bab61c55b8d29cfdb0380cd85f2a8e41a2f2f889f5e05bbbf8aa4d28bcf94b
confirmations
158635
spent
true